What Makes Great SaaS
Building successful software as a service is about far more than writing code. The best products solve a genuine problem elegantly, offer an intuitive user experience, and scale reliably as customer numbers grow. Strong customer support, continuous improvement, and thoughtful onboarding are equally important, as SaaS businesses depend on retaining subscribers over the long term.
Security and data protection are also paramount. Because SaaS products often store sensitive customer information in the cloud, leading companies invest heavily in robust infrastructure, encryption, and compliance. Northumberland's top SaaS firms understand that trust is the foundation of the subscription relationship and treat it accordingly, embedding reliability and transparency into everything they build.

Trends Shaping the SaaS Sector
The SaaS landscape is evolving quickly. Artificial intelligence is increasingly being embedded into products, offering features such as intelligent automation, predictive insights, and conversational interfaces. Vertical SaaS, meaning software tailored to a specific industry, is gaining momentum as customers seek solutions that fit their exact needs rather than generic tools.
Integration has also become essential. Modern businesses use many different applications, and the most successful SaaS products connect seamlessly with other tools through open interfaces. Northumberland's leading companies recognise this and design their products to be part of a wider ecosystem, adding value by working smoothly alongside the software their customers already rely on.
